Output 8ecaa17cbb3a87fa3260cef411de843198e0cbbe26dda86d726ae0e7ac58ce71:651

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7393e3f0a25468085d0203fd24dbfdde8b1f150c88d259889ccfcf814c9beb71
address
bc1pwwf78u9z235qshgzq07jfklam69379gv3rf9nzyuel8cznymadcsv8pjzj
transaction
8ecaa17cbb3a87fa3260cef411de843198e0cbbe26dda86d726ae0e7ac58ce71
spent
true